If a grilling accident in your house leaves a guest injured, a storm damages your home, or a burglar breaks in, the biggest worry is always about whether or not you’ll recover from the loss. Each time an unfortunate event occurs in your Florida or Michigan home, you may be forced to file a claim with an insurance company. But, a claim against a homeowner’s policy comes with various regulations and procedures that you and the insurer must follow. Even though it’s advisable to contact a reliable agency like America’s Choice Insurance Partners in Wixom, MI, it’s still essential for you to understand the claim procedure. Here are the steps to get you started.
Contact the police
If your house has been burglarized or you are a victim of theft, report the case to the police. Be sure to get a police report, including the names of the officers you speak with since you will need to offer these details to your insurer.
Report the incident to your insurance provider
Your insurance provider should be able to inform you if the incident is covered, the duration of filing a claim, and if the request exceeds your deductible. They will let you know the period it’ll take to process the claim and if you’ll need to get estimations of the structural damage.
Fill out claim forms promptly
Once you establish that you can make a claim, your insurer will send the necessary claim forms within a specified time as required by law. Fill them out promptly to avoid delays.
Create a list of damaged or lost items
Since you need to substantiate your loss, create a list of damaged or destroyed items. Ensure you have a copy for your adjuster. Additionally, supply them with available copies of receipts for the damaged or stolen items.
